Has anyone used Commvault or Novastor backup software on their Windows 2000 Servers (Exchange,SQL) and what problems if any have you run into with either one software?
 
We're using Galaxy, but I've not heard of Novastor. If you're goign to be backing up Windows, and Exchange, take a look at this link Or, go to microsoft.com and search on CommVault. Microsoft owns part of the company, and their document on how to back up the Microsoft Enterprise mentions only one backup vendor....CommVault. It works great, and can back up Exchange down to the object level (email, contact, note, etc.)
 
Their Exchange support is not exclusive to CommVault. Other BU vendors have the same functionality.
What is your environment? They are a good solution if your a small shop but there can be issues in larger environments with many distributed systems. OK though if your all Windows. Nice UI also.
